Output 6bca18640625af30947f27012bd7a9ac26c692b35dc4f205d1215f7a3ba4979a:1

value
643209
script pubkey
OP_0 OP_PUSHBYTES_20 95349ff20bcf03b4640a54b39dc88e80a52085b1
address
bc1qj56flusteupmgeq22jeemjywszjjppd35pvukn
transaction
6bca18640625af30947f27012bd7a9ac26c692b35dc4f205d1215f7a3ba4979a